The 1956 Dodgers were undoubtedly greeted by many "Konnichiwas" upon their arrival in Japan during a goodwill tour following their heartbreaking, seven-game World Series loss to the rival Yankees. This 14-inch-wide mini travel bag was given to players and executives for the trip, and this particular one is in decent condition despite showing heavy use. The front reads: BROOKLYN DODGERS TOUR OF JAPAN 1956" complete with familiar logo. The back reads: "PAA PAN AMERICAN WORLD AIRWAYS" and the lettering is faded. The zipper is not functional and there are small cracks ion the inside lining, but they scarcely detract from such a cool item.
